Un sistema "Legacy" (o sistema heredado) se refiere a un sistema de software, hardware o tecnología que ha estado en uso durante un período prolongado y que, a menudo, es obsoleto o desactualizado en comparación con las tecnologías más recientes. Estos sistemas pueden ser difíciles de mantener, actualizar o integrar con nuevas tecnologías debido a su diseño antiguo o a la falta de documentación. La gestión de sistemas Legacy a menudo representa desafíos para las organizaciones, ya que pueden ser costosos de mantener y limitar la capacidad de innovación tecnológica.
Realizar una auditoría de tecnología en un sistema Legacy puede ser un proceso complejo pero necesario. Aquí hay una guía general para llevar a cabo una auditoría:
1. Identificar los objetivos: Comienza por definir claramente los objetivos de la auditoría. ¿Qué aspectos del sistema Legacy se deben evaluar? ¿Cuáles son los riesgos o problemas que deseas abordar?
2. Equipo de auditoría: Reúne un equipo de auditoría que incluya expertos en tecnología, desarrolladores, administradores de sistemas y otros profesionales que comprendan el sistema Legacy y sus necesidades.
3. Documentación: Recopila toda la documentación disponible sobre el sistema Legacy, incluyendo manuales, diagramas de arquitectura, códigos fuente, registros de cambios, y cualquier información relevante.
4. Evaluación de hardware y software: Analiza el hardware y software en uso, incluyendo servidores, sistemas operativos, bases de datos, aplicaciones, y cualquier componente relacionado. Identifica versiones, configuraciones y estado de mantenimiento.
5. Seguridad: Evalúa la seguridad del sistema Legacy, buscando vulnerabilidades y posibles riesgos. Asegúrate de cumplir con las regulaciones de seguridad y privacidad aplicables.
6. Rendimiento y eficiencia: Mide el rendimiento y eficiencia del sistema. ¿Está funcionando lentamente? ¿Se han producido caídas del sistema? Identifica cuellos de botella y áreas de mejora.
7. Costos y recursos: Examina los costos asociados con el sistema Legacy, incluyendo licencias, mantenimiento y personal. Determina si hay oportunidades para reducir costos.
8. Integridad de datos: Verifica la integridad de los datos almacenados en el sistema Legacy y evalúa la calidad de los datos.
9. Cumplimiento normativo: Asegúrate de que el sistema cumple con las regulaciones y estándares de la industria aplicables, como GDPR, HIPAA, etc.
10. Recomendaciones: Basado en los hallazgos de la auditoría, elabora un informe que incluya recomendaciones para mejorar, modernizar o reemplazar el sistema Legacy, si es necesario.
11. Plan de acción: Desarrolla un plan de acción detallado que priorice las recomendaciones y establezca plazos para su implementación.
12. Implementación: Lleva a cabo las mejoras recomendadas de acuerdo con el plan de acción, garantizando la minimización de riesgos y la continuidad del negocio.
Una auditoría de tecnología en un sistema Legacy puede ser un proyecto complejo que requiere tiempo y recursos, pero puede ayudar a optimizar la eficiencia, reducir costos y mitigar riesgos asociados con sistemas obsoletos.
Comments